DOUGLASS-Wright, Marvin M., 84, passed to eternal life Wednesday, May 18, 2011. Visitation Sunday, 2-8 with Rosary at 6 p.m., all at Smith Family Mortuary, 1415 N. Rock Rd., Derby. Funeral service 10 a.m. Monday at St. Mary Faith Center, 2300 E. Meadowlark, Derby. Marvin was an avid outdoorsman. He began as a Nebraska farm boy. Before retiring from 30 years in the Air Force, he bought a farm. He truly enjoyed raising horses, cattle, turkeys, and chickens. Beyond his military career, he also earned his Master’s Degree. He continued his love of learning by taking classes on Heating and Air Conditioning and Transmission Repair. In both subjects, he quickly took over the teaching of the courses. Preceded in death by a son, Bob Wright; sister Bonnie George; and brother Keith Wright. Marvin is survived by his wife, Gloria; children Kathy (Pete) Trickey, Greeneville, Tenn.; John (Melanie) Wright, Arkansas City; Debbi (Loren) Perry, Wichita; Bill (Keri) Wright, Fall River; six grandchildren, and two great-grandchildren; siblings Lyle Wright, Lloyd Wright, Mary O’Brien, Eileen Frost, and Kermit Wright. In lieu of flowers, memorials have been established with Harry Hynes Hospice, 313 S. Market, Wichita, KS 67202, and Victory in the Valley, 3755 E. Douglas, Wichita, KS 67218.
